[Resolved]  Ford Ikon 1.6 Nxt — Inferior quality service

I went for the Ford IKON 1.6 Nxt. on Dec 31, 2003. With every passing day my fancy for the car wore off due to high maintenance and fragile. With in years I had to replace the parts one by one. Now after four and half years of having the car I have to spend more than Rs 50k. The car has become an expensive one that I want to get rid off.

A couple of months later, I have to replace the front and rear suspension, power windows switch, battery and a lot more of parts. A car that has run barely 60 KMs needs all new suspension I can’t believe this. The power windows switch is completely malfunctioned after 3 years of careful use and not to say about the side mirrors. This was probably a deliberate feature of Ford design. When contacted their dealer I was told that this sort of maintenance was normal for a car. Not all cars but for Ford cars may be. Another appalling feature of Ford is that they refuse to escalate the complaints with their superiors. I have serious doubts whether their senior management knows that their vehicles have serious problems.

Looking at the pattern of faults and malfunction, as a quality management analyst I can deduce that low quality material was used and there is poor or no quality assurance in their manufacturing process. These cars cannot withstand the rigors of Indian roads. They are made of cheap substandard material and have a high failure rate. I advise every body not buy these Ford cars unless you have enough time, money to spare.

I have a ford Ikon car done 52000km and find that the ford car manufactured in India are substandard in design. I have used Fords cars in USA / Africa and my friends in Middle East have had no complain about FORD cars., why only in India FORD INDIA has deliberately designed cars so that spare parts sells is the only business. Just to give you 4 examples.

1. I have *replace two fuel pumps* within 38500Km run as the design does not have a safety lock to switch of the fuel pump when tank is empty and fuel pump gets damaged / burnt. One way the Ford India cars are designed so that first time owners in India who do not know about safety lock end up pay for fuel pumps. Normally when there is no fuel in tank there should be automatic lock to signal fuel pump to stop pumping and protect it. FORD India has deliberately got this design so that fuel pumps can be replaced as often as possible. Cost of fuel pump is Rs 18, 000 or so.

2..I have replaced electric coil within 24000km run costing me Rs 15, 000. There was no reason why the electric coil is damaged. Customer care of Ford India say it is just wear and tear of car

3. Within 38000km the front shock absorbers had to be replaced. I am surprised that for roads in Mumbia shock absorbers need to be replaced. The FORD franchise outlets say that shock absorbers life is only 20, 000KM. Actually the design of the shock absorbers is not designed for the weight of the car engine. I am sure out of my experience of driving in Africa where roads are really bad and shock absorbers need not be changes after 20000km run. What a shame for FORD product.

4. Within 50000km I spend another Rs 80, 000 because ...The coolant system / engine block have a plastic manifold connection that regulates the AC cooling motor. This plastic manifold cracked and the coolant leaked. The plastic manifold cost Rs 5, 800. But this caused engine to overheat and all major components of the coolant system and the engine block were damaged. Why should FORD INDIA have such wrong designs without cut off and safety switch off? Because of plastic manifold crack I have to replace a lot of parts associated due to over heating. This has happen within 52000Km run. I have driven cars in Africa and had not faced such issue. The critical part is made of plastic manifold (substandard part) with wear and tear will give way like in my case


With the above experience the INDIAN FORD cars have a life of just about 50, 000KM only. I have paid over Rs 1.50, 000 (Rs 1.5lakh) rupees for service / spare parts and maintenance. THIS IS THE STORY OF FORD INDIA CARS
